Acute intestinal infections in children during the pre-pandemic period and during the COVID-19 pandemic period in Yakutsk

Abstract

Humanity has faced an infection caused by a new strain of human coronavirus SARS-CoV-2. The infection is characterized by a variety of clinical symptoms with damage not only to the respiratory tract, but also to other organs and systems. Against the background of the pandemic of a new coronavirus infection, the widespread introduction of anti-epidemic measures has led to a change in the situation with other infectious diseases. The purpose of this work was to analyze the incidence of acute intestinal infections among children in the city of Yakutsk. Acute intestinal infections (AII) refer to diseases that are transmitted by the alimentary route. In the Russian Federation, from the very beginning of the epidemic manifestations of COVID-19, a course has been taken to implement the “advanced response” strategy, in accordance with which all anti-epidemic measures have been and are being carried out. The restrictive measures introduced as part of the fight against the spread of COVID-19 have had a beneficial effect on the epidemiological situation with many other infections. Many countries have implemented social distancing as a measure to “flatten the curve” of the ongoing epidemic. The results obtained by us coincide with the data obtained in other regions during similar studies. The decrease in the number of cases of most infectious diseases is a fact common to countries where anti-epidemic measures have been taken. We analyzed data on hospitalized patients with AII in the Children’s Clinical Infectious Diseases Hospital in Yakutsk for 2018, 2019, and 2020. We identified some features of the dynamics of the incidence of acute intestinal infections in children in the pre-pandemic period and in the first year of the COVID-19 pandemic. The introduction of anti-epidemic measures against the background of a new coronavirus infection led to a significant decrease in the incidence of infectious diseases in general and to a significant decrease in the number of acute intestinal infections in children.
